At least 52 individuals perished during the onslaught of Typhoon Tino in the Province of Negros Occidental on November 4, 2025, according to data from the Provincial Disaster Risk Reduction and Management Office (PDRRMO).

Of the local government units (LGUs), La Castellana has logged the most number of casualties at ten (10). Moises Padilla has nine (9), while Hinigaran has eight (8).

PDRRMO said that the figures could change because of ongoing verification with the Department of the Interior and Local Government.

Meanwhile, a total of 137,596 families, or 517,793 individuals, have been affected by Typhoon Tino in Negros Occidental based on PDRRMO report.

Of the said figures, 23,887 families or 77,590 individuals stayed at evacuation centers.

Delivery of relief assistance from the Provincial Government and the Department of Social Welfare and Development to affected residents is ongoing, as of this writing.
